What this service involves
What this service involves
You will be asked a few quick questions and have your blood pressure measured using an arm cuff while you sit and rest. The result is explained in plain language, including what may affect it on the day. You will leave with clear, practical next steps and advice on when to re-check.
Straightforward and comfortable
The cuff tightens briefly, then relaxes, and most people find the check easy and comfortable.
Time for your questions
You can talk through any concerns and get help understanding how blood pressure relates to everyday health.

What happens during a blood pressure check?
You will sit down and rest briefly, then an arm cuff is placed on your upper arm to take a reading. You will be told your numbers and what they may mean for you.
How long does the appointment take?
Your appointment usually takes around 10 minutes, including time to take the reading and talk through the result.
Do I need to do anything to prepare?
If you can, avoid caffeine, smoking, and strenuous activity shortly beforehand, and arrive a few minutes early so you can sit calmly before the reading.
What should I bring with me?
Bring a list of any regular medicines and let us know about anything that might affect the reading, such as recent exercise, stress, or feeling unwell.
What happens after I get my result?
You will be given clear next steps, which may include lifestyle advice, repeating the check, or guidance on seeking further assessment if needed.
